Operation Guide
Thank You for purchasing another quality GSL Product.
The SR 1212 is a Negative Switched PWM Solar Panel Regulator which is feature rich and powerful for it’s size due to it’s
microcontroller based design with the added bonus of polymer encapsulation making it water and weather proof.
Featuring:
• Operating from panels that are peak rated to 250W
• Very high efficiency, typically over 98%
• Low night time discharge current, below 10mA.
• Selectable multichemistry. For Sealed Lead Acid , Flooded Cell Lead Acid and Lithium (LiFePO4) chemistries. (Note: This
feature is only available on SR1212-2 only. The SR1212-1 fixed for Flooded Cell Lead Acid)
• Simple Status LED Indication (SR1212-2 model only)
• High operating temperatures - Safely work up to 70°C.
• High reliablity due to dual over temperature protection.
• Built in Low Voltage Disconnect (LVD) (SR1212-2 model only)
• Advanced 3 stage automatic PWM charging algorithm

Operational Parameters
SR1212-1 SR1212-2
Maximum Current at Bulk Charge 12A 12A
Input Operating Voltage Range 15V to 25Volts 15V to 25Volts
Maximum Charge Voltage for Flooded Cell (LEAD
ACID)
14.6Volts 14.6Volts
Maximum Charge Voltage for Lithium - 14.4Volts
Maximum Charge Voltage for AGM/GEL - 14.2Volts
Float Voltage 13.5Volts 13.5Volts
Lithium Maintenance Charge - 13.2V
Standby Current 0.01A 0.01A
Maximum Operating Temperature 70°C 70°C
Automatic Derating Above 45°C 0.5A/°C 0.5A/°C
Typical Efciency 98% 98%
LVD On/Off - On : <11V OFF : <12.5V
Status LED - YES
Dimensions 81mm(L) x 37mm(W) x 22mm(H) 81mm(L) x 37mm(W) x 22mm(H)
Weight 50g 70g
• Use only PV systems with open circuit voltage below 25v and 250W rated peak power.
• Install the unit away from ammable liquids or gases.
• Use wires suitable for at least 15A, but if wire runs are over 3m then larger wires are recommended to limit voltage
drop and losses.
• A battery fuse ( BF ) is always required and must be located as close as possible to the positive battery terminal and
before any other connection. The fuse ratings will depend on the wire size and load but typically a 15A fuse
is envisaged.
• Before connecting always check battery and PV panel polarity & Do not short PV or Load with Battery connected!
• Always check that the correct chemistry setting is used and that the voltage levels are suitable for your specic
battery.
• Only use Lithium batteries with a suitable BMS.
• This appliance is not meant for use by young children.
• During the charging process on a vented battery do not use a naked ame near a battery which may ignite and explode.
• Never smoke or light cigarettes near a battery.
• Do not place tools on top of battery or allow tools to fall on to the battery.
• Always wear eye protection near a charging battery.
• Ensure a “well” ventilated area is used when testing or charging batteries.
• Ensure ventilation is adequate and venting holes are not obstructed.
• If skin or clothing comes into contact with acid, ush the area(s) with water immediately and seek medical attention if
necessary.
